How we work

Fees quoted before you commit

You get the total in writing — notarial fee plus any travel — before you confirm anything. We charge no more than the statutory maximum for in-person acts, and we don't add charges at the table.

Done properly, every time

Identity verified, signature witnessed, certificate completed, journal entry recorded. If something about a signing isn't lawful, we say so and stop — a notarization that gets rejected later helps nobody.

Available when you need it

Appointments seven days a week, evenings included. Hospital and care facility visits are routine for us, and same-day online sessions are frequently available.

What a notary can and cannot do

This is worth stating plainly, because the boundary trips people up constantly.

A Nevada notary public can verify the identity of signers, witness signatures, administer oaths and affirmations, take acknowledgments and jurats, certify copies where permitted, and complete the notarial certificate.

A Nevada notary public cannot draft your document, choose which form you need, explain what your document means, correct or fill in your document for you, or advise you on the legal consequences of signing. Those are the practice of law.

I am not an attorney licensed to practice law in Nevada and cannot give legal advice. I cannot explain or recommend what type of document you need, or how it should be completed. If you need legal guidance, please consult a licensed Nevada attorney.
